Life Inside a Psychiatric Hospital: What to Expect
Adjusting to a environment within a psychiatric institution can be challenging and strange. Anticipate a structured routine, often starting with a prompt wake-up hour. Your daily activities might include private therapy meetings, group discussions, and treatment management.
- Patients may have limited access to private belongings.
- Communication with loved ones is typically regulated through the institution's policies.
- The focus is on healing and gaining coping skills.
Choosing a Exclusive Mental Hospital : Crucial Points
Determining for a private mental facility requires thorough evaluation . Initiate by looking into regional options and confirming certification status . Direct attention to the team's experience and the breadth of treatment services offered . In addition, think about the setting - is it calming and nurturing? Finally , do not hesitating to ask questions regarding fees, policy reimbursement and admission requirements.
